Ben Paz La Salsa Geisha*Roast Date: June 3rd* This Geisha comes from the most decorated coffee producer in the history of Honduras: Benjamin Paz. As always, Bens coffee is stellar. Its a washed geisha from his famous farm, La Salsa. La Salsa was planted with a range of seeds from several world class producers from Panama, including Hartmann, Elida, and Jameson.
